Output 065034b64d2016cfe0350270055a61a493439c6c2a2aef6915d1d70bfa88748a:8

value
21490499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d8df911ee5e1b6cf3d87b2dfda611938c04119 OP_EQUAL
address
MH6PcEaHRviTGwGRrJ3c2Liyhk8cKv8Sxy
transaction
065034b64d2016cfe0350270055a61a493439c6c2a2aef6915d1d70bfa88748a
spent
true